短信验证码收取失败后,如何避免重复发送?
在现代社会,短信验证码已成为各大平台验证用户身份的重要手段。然而,由于网络环境、手机设置等多种因素,用户可能会遇到短信验证码收取失败的情况。为了避免重复发送短信验证码给用户带来不必要的困扰,以下是一些有效的策略和建议。
一、优化短信发送系统
系统稳定性:确保短信发送系统的稳定性,减少因系统故障导致的短信发送失败。定期对系统进行维护和升级,提高系统的抗风险能力。
优化短信内容:在短信内容中明确告知用户短信验证码的重要性,提高用户对短信的重视程度。同时,优化短信格式,使其更加简洁明了,便于用户识别。
跟踪发送状态:系统应具备跟踪短信发送状态的功能,一旦发现短信发送失败,立即进行重试,直至成功发送或达到最大重试次数。
二、提高用户接收效率
短信发送时间:选择在用户较为空闲的时间段发送短信验证码,如工作日晚上或周末。这样可以提高用户接收短信的概率。
提醒用户查看短信:在发送短信验证码前,向用户发送一条提醒短信,告知其即将收到验证码,提高用户对短信的期待值。
多渠道通知:除了短信,还可以通过其他渠道通知用户,如邮件、微信、APP推送等。这样即使短信发送失败,用户也能在其他渠道收到验证码。
三、优化用户操作流程
简化操作步骤:在用户申请验证码时,简化操作步骤,减少用户在操作过程中遇到的问题。例如,将验证码发送方式设置为自动发送,无需用户手动操作。
提供反馈渠道:在用户操作过程中,提供反馈渠道,如在线客服、电话客服等。用户在遇到问题时,可以及时得到帮助。
自动重发机制:当用户在规定时间内未收到短信验证码时,系统应自动重发验证码。但需注意,重发次数不宜过多,以免给用户带来不必要的骚扰。
四、加强用户教育
宣传验证码重要性:通过平台公告、邮件、短信等方式,向用户宣传验证码的重要性,提高用户对验证码的重视程度。
教育用户正确操作:向用户介绍验证码的正确接收和使用方法,避免因用户操作失误导致短信验证码收取失败。
提醒用户注意手机设置:告知用户在手机设置中开启短信接收功能,以免因手机设置导致短信验证码收取失败。
五、合理设置重发间隔
根据实际情况,合理设置短信验证码的重发间隔。如:第一次发送失败后,等待5分钟再重发;若连续两次发送失败,则等待10分钟再重发。
避免短时间内频繁重发,以免给用户带来不必要的骚扰。
六、引入备用验证方式
在短信验证码发送失败的情况下,可以引入备用验证方式,如语音验证、图形验证、邮箱验证等。
根据用户需求,提供多种备用验证方式,提高验证码接收成功率。
总之,为了避免短信验证码收取失败后重复发送,我们需要从多个方面入手,优化短信发送系统、提高用户接收效率、优化用户操作流程、加强用户教育、合理设置重发间隔以及引入备用验证方式。通过这些措施,可以有效提高短信验证码的接收成功率,为用户提供更好的服务体验。
猜你喜欢:即时通讯云